Pros:
Service and value.
Cons:
They really do not have the room set up well for thier lunch time buffet.
|
|
I visited Morton pub with a friend on a Friday for their noon hour buffet. Anticipating a crowed we showed up at 11:30. It was a good choice because by 12:00 the place was packed.
The server was fast to seat us and take our orders. Seeing how busy they get, fast service is a necessity. I find buffets more difficult to review because you get to sample many things, in my case, as many items as are present! Generally speaking their buffet is good quality food. There were a few items that I did not care for much like the fake wings. But there were others that I went back for seconds of. Over all I enjoyed the buffet. If you go at peak traffic hours, like 12:00 noon, be prepared to have a 10-20 person line waiting for food. The place is not designed well for that many people because you have to push through the line to get back out of the buffet section and return to your seat.
